From New York Times bestselling author Bernard Cornwell, the first book in the Grail Series—the spellbinding tale of a young man, a fearless archer, who sets out wanting to avenge his family's honor and winds up on a quest for the Holy Grail. A brutal raid on the quiet coastal English village of Hookton in 1342 leaves but one survivor: a young archer named Thomas. On this terrible dawn, his purpose becomes clear—to recover a stolen sacred relic and pursue to the ends of the earth the murderous black-clad knight bearing a blue-and-yellow standard, a journey that leads him to the courageous rescue of a beautiful French woman, and sets him on his ultimate quest: the search for the Holy Grail.

This book takes a unique look into the journey of a world-class archer, who, at the age of 14, qualified for the 1988 Olympic Games. Nobody would have expected her to come away with a medal, but what "they" didn't know was this teenager's tenacity to succeed. In this intriguing book, Denise Parker recounts all aspects of her archery career. From the countless hours of practice, to the joy of winning, to the delicate balance of external pressure -- this book tells it all. It is the perfect read for any child or teenager who strives to achieve greatness and also provides parents and mentors insights to help any child or young adult to achieve his/her dreams.

The second thrilling adventure in a new historical series from million-copy-selling Caroline Lawrence, set in Roman Britain during the reign of the evil Emperor Domitian. Britannia AD 94. On the run from the Emperor Domitian, fifteen-year-old Fronto has joined the Roman army in order to find the security and structure he craves. But when his younger sister Ursula is captured by a terrifying Druid called Snakebeard, he must make an impossible decision. Can he leave the army, when desertion is punishable by death? His desire: To become a good soldier His quest: To rescue his sister His destiny: To find his place in Roman Britain From the bestselling author of THE ROMAN MYSTERIES, perfect for children studying at Key Stage 2. Historical locations featured in this book are a British Iron Age Village, Bath Spa and the fortress at Caerleon.

#1 New York Times best-selling novelist Brad Meltzer's seminal Green Arrow story is back in this deluxe-edition graphic novel! What do you do when you're back from the dead? Road trip. With a second chance at life, Oliver Queen has some unfinished business. Green Arrow must find the lost treasures of his first life to preserve his past and discover what his new life means. Roy Harper, his former ward now known as Arsenal, joins him as they cross the country, encountering the likes of the Shade, Solomon Grundy and even the pathetic Catman! Along the way, Ollie finds out what is truly important to him... Featuring Brad Meltzer's DC Comics debut and the acclaimed art team of Phil Hester and Ande Parks, GREEN ARROW: THE ARCHER QUEST DELUXE EDITION collects GREEN ARROW #16-21.
